33

回帖

1万

金币

5756

积分

积分
5756
发表于 2024-3-10 15:08:15 | 显示全部楼层 |阅读模式

马上注册,下载996引擎,与更多游戏开发者交流。

您需要 登录 才可以下载或查看,没有账号?注册

×
想根据玩家转生等级,然后如果没有到达指定转生,就不能在通过打怪获取经验,自己写的经验丹之内的可以手动控制,但是怪物表里的怪物经验,没找到方法控制,用@GetExp的接口也return false还是stop(),都停不住经验
回复

使用道具 举报

33

回帖

1万

金币

5756

积分

积分
5756
 楼主| 发表于 2024-3-10 15:28:54 | 显示全部楼层
我在QFunction-0.txt的GetExp里return 0,成功停止了获取怪物经验,但我实际的逻辑是导到了lua里去的,lua里return 0还是无法终止操作
[@GetExp]
#if
#act
calllua zhongzhuan @expget,<$GetExp>
return 0 --可以停止经验
function expget(actor, aexp)
return 0
--return false
end


回复

使用道具 举报